Breathe Underwater: Try Scuba at Kilkee Waterworld
A supervised, one-hour pool session at Kilkee Waterworld that lets first-timers aged 10 and over feel scuba gear, learn basic skills, and decide whether to pursue open-water training.

In a controlled pool environment at Kilkee Waterworld, the Try Scuba experience introduces first-time divers to the sensation of breathing underwater, the feel of scuba equipment, and a handful of core skills — all taught by a fully qualified professional in a single, hour-long session.
Highlights
Outing Highlights
Feel the Gear and Breathe Underwater
The session begins with a briefing on the mask, tank and regulator, then moves into the pool so participants can experience what it’s like to breathe and move with scuba equipment — a simple, focused introduction to the fundamentals.
Fully Qualified Supervision
Every Try Scuba is run under the watch of a fully qualified professional who teaches essential safety rules and basic diving skills useful for anyone considering the full open-water diver course.
One Hour to Find Out If You Like It
Designed as a compact discovery experience, the Try Scuba lasts approximately one hour and includes changing time, a briefing and pool practice so you can quickly decide whether scuba is for you.

What the Hour Feels Like
The flow is straightforward: a briefing on how the equipment works, fitting up with regulator and tank, then a short, coached session in the Water World swimming pool where you learn basic skills, get comfortable breathing underwater and test whether diving sparks your interest.

Practical planner
Details to review before reserving
The session runs for approximately one hour including changing time; meet at Kilkee Waterworld at your designated start time.
Bring swimwear, towel and a swim cap; goggles are listed as an item to bring as well. The operator provides the scuba mask, tank and regulator.
Minimum age is 10. Read the provided medical questionnaire carefully — if you answer yes to certain questions you will need a doctor’s clearance before joining.
